How to create a campaign by selecting LinkedIn Search URL

Learn how to create a campaign in Meet Drake by using a LinkedIn Search URL as your audience source. By applying filters in LinkedIn before copying the search URL, you can target the right prospects and improve your campaign results.

Meet Drake allows you to build campaigns using a LinkedIn Search URL as your audience source.

This option enables Meet Drake to gather publicly available information from the LinkedIn profiles that appear in your search results, helping you reach the right leads.

Example:
If your ideal leads are Marketing Managers, enter "Marketing Manager" in LinkedIn's search bar.

Before copying the URL, narrow down your search by applying relevant filters, such as:

  • Connection level (1st, 2nd, or 3rd-degree connections)

  • Location (cities, states, or countries)

  • Industry

  • Company size

  • Current company

  • Other available LinkedIn filters

Using filters helps you create a more targeted audience and improve campaign performance.

Once your search results are ready, copy the URL displayed in your browser's address bar.

Add the URL to Your Campaign

  1. Open Meet Drake.

  2. Create a new campaign or edit an existing one.

  3. Go to the Audience section.

  4. Select LinkedIn Search URL as the campaign source.

  5. Paste the LinkedIn Search URL you copied earlier.

Meet Drake will use the search results to build your campaign audience.
